Быстродействие и эффективность работы файловой базы в популярной системе 1С – ключевые факторы, определяющие производительность всего предприятия. Ведь, когда база данных работает медленно и тормозит, это отражается на каждом шаге бизнес-процесса. Но не отчаивайтесь! В этой статье вы узнаете несколько простых и эффективных методов, которые помогут увеличить скорость работы вашей файловой базы и избавиться от нежелательных тормозов.
1. Оптимизация индексов базы данных. Индексы являются основой работы базы данных и позволяют быстро искать и извлекать нужные данные. Неправильно созданные или устаревшие индексы могут замедлить работу базы данных. Проверьте и оптимизируйте индексы вашей базы, удаляя неиспользуемые индексы и создавая новые.
2. Увеличение ресурсов сервера. Если ваш сервер не обладает достаточными ресурсами, то это может стать причиной тормозов базы данных. Рассмотрите возможность увеличения оперативной памяти сервера, улучшения процессора или добавления дополнительного жесткого диска. Помните, что лишние ресурсы не бывают лишними, а только обеспечивают более стабильную и быструю работу базы данных.
3. Проверка конфигурации и настроек 1С. Возможно, для вашей конфигурации 1С необходимо внести определенные изменения в настройки, чтобы увеличить скорость работы базы данных. Проверьте и оптимизируйте настройки кэша, автономного режима, предзагрузки данных и другие параметры, которые могут повлиять на производительность системы.
4. Удаление неиспользуемых объектов. Чем больше объектов в базе данных, тем сложнее идет ее обработка. Избавьтесь от неиспользуемых объектов, таких как удаленные пользователи или устаревшие отчеты. Это поможет снизить нагрузку на базу данных и ускорит ее работу.
Используя эти простые и эффективные методы, вы сможете значительно увеличить скорость работы файловой базы 1С и избавиться от неприятных тормозов. Помните, что важно регулярно проверять и оптимизировать работу базы данных, чтобы быть уверенным в эффективности работы всей системы.
- Увеличение скорости работы файловой базы 1С
- Использование индексов для оптимизации запросов
- Создание индексов на наиболее часто используемые поля
- Удаление неиспользуемых индексов для сокращения времени выполнения запросов
- Оптимизация работы с кэшем
- Увеличение размера кэша для улучшения производительности
- Использование быстрого кэша для повышения скорости доступа к данным
- Разделение базы данных на отдельные файлы
- Вопрос-ответ:
- Почему моя файловая база 1С работает медленно и часто тормозит?
- Какие меры можно принять для увеличения скорости работы файловой базы 1С?
- Какие инструменты и техники можно использовать для оптимизации работы файловой базы 1С?
- Почему скорость работы файловой базы 1С может быть замедленной?
- Видео:
- Как ускорить работу ваших программ 1С?
Увеличение скорости работы файловой базы 1С
Для увеличения скорости работы файловой базы 1С можно использовать несколько методов и подходов:
- Оптимизация структуры базы данных: Необходимо проводить регулярные анализы и оптимизации базы данных, чтобы убедиться в ее эффективности. Это включает в себя устранение дублирующихся данных, оптимизацию индексов и типов данных, а также удаление неиспользуемых объектов.
- Использование кэша: Кэширование данных позволяет ускорить доступ к информации, которая часто используется. В 1С это можно сделать с помощью «списка значений», который позволяет сохранять результаты выполнения запросов на длительное время.
- Разделение базы данных: Если база данных становится слишком большой, рекомендуется ее разделить на более мелкие файлы. Это позволит уменьшить время, необходимое для обработки данных, и повысить производительность системы в целом.
- Настройка сервера: Дополнительные настройки сервера могут помочь увеличить скорость работы файловой базы. Это может включать в себя оптимизацию параметров памяти, увеличение количества одновременно обрабатываемых запросов и настройку параметров кэширования.
- Обновление программного обеспечения: Версии 1С Предприятия постоянно обновляются, и новые версии могут содержать улучшения, включающие оптимизацию работы с файловой базой.
В результате применения этих методов и подходов можно значительно увеличить скорость работы файловой базы 1С, сократить время выполнения операций и улучшить общую производительность системы. Это особенно важно в случаях, когда база данных растет и становится более сложной.
Использование индексов для оптимизации запросов
Для оптимизации скорости работы файловой базы в 1С полезно использовать индексы. Индексы представляют собой специальные структуры данных, которые позволяют ускорить поиск и сортировку информации в базе данных.
Индексы создаются на полях таблиц, которые часто используются в запросах. При создании индекса, система 1С создает отдельную структуру, где сохраняет упорядоченные значения поля и ссылки на соответствующие записи. Благодаря этому, поиск данных по индексированным полям выполняется значительно быстрее, что ускоряет работу с базой данных.
При оптимизации запросов следует использовать индексированные поля в условиях поиска и сортировки. Например, если вам нужно найти все записи, где значение поля «Название» равно «Товар 1», то использование индекса на это поле значительно ускорит выполнение запроса.
Кроме того, стоит помнить, что при изменении данных в индексированных полях, индексы также должны быть обновлены. Поэтому после массовых изменений в базе данных, рекомендуется провести обновление индексов для поддержания их актуальности.
Создание индексов на наиболее часто используемые поля
Для увеличения скорости работы файловой базы 1С и избавления от тормозов рекомендуется создавать индексы на наиболее часто используемые поля. Индексы позволяют ускорить поиск и сортировку данных в базе, что в свою очередь приводит к повышению производительности системы.
Индексирование делается на основе значений полей, которые часто используются в запросах. Например, если в базе данных есть таблица «Сотрудники» и поле «Фамилия», по которому осуществляется поиск и сортировка, то создание индекса на это поле значительно ускорит работу с данными.
При создании индексов следует учитывать, что они занимают дополнительное место на диске, а также замедляют операции изменения данных. Поэтому не рекомендуется создавать индексы на все поля базы данных, а только на те, которые действительно часто используются.
Для создания индексов в 1С необходимо открыть конфигурацию базы данных в режиме разработки, перейти в режим конфигурирования и выбрать нужную таблицу. Затем нужно выбрать поле, на которое нужно создать индекс, и выбрать опцию «Индексы» в контекстном меню. Далее нужно создать новый индекс, указав его имя и установив параметры сортировки.
После создания индекса его необходимо активировать и выполнить обновление базы данных. После этого индекс будет использоваться в запросах и ускорит работу системы.
Важно помнить, что перед созданием индексов следует провести анализ и определить, на каких полях они будут наиболее эффективны. Также следует регулярно проводить мониторинг и оптимизацию индексов для поддержания оптимальной производительности базы данных.
Удаление неиспользуемых индексов для сокращения времени выполнения запросов
Процесс удаления неиспользуемых индексов в файловой базе 1С может быть выполнен следующими шагами:
- Анализ использования индексов.
- Определение неиспользуемых индексов.
- Удаление неиспользуемых индексов.
Анализ использования индексов можно выполнить с помощью специальных инструментов или запросов к системе. При анализе следует обратить внимание на те индексы, которые имеют низкое значение выборки или не используются вообще. Также стоит учесть, что удаление некоторых индексов может привести к увеличению времени выполнения определенных запросов.
После определения неиспользуемых индексов можно перейти к их удалению. Удаление индексов должно быть выполнено после анализа и обдуманного решения, чтобы не повредить производительность системы. Перед удалением индексов рекомендуется создать резервную копию базы данных для возможности восстановления в случае ошибки.
Удаление неиспользуемых индексов позволит сократить время выполнения запросов к базе данных и увеличить скорость работы файловой базы 1С. Это может быть особенно важно для крупных баз данных, где количество записей и запросов значительно.
Оптимизация работы с кэшем
Для оптимизации работы с кэшем в файловой базе 1С можно использовать следующие подходы:
- Настройка кэширования данных: В файловой базе 1С можно настроить кэширование данных, чтобы минимизировать обращение к физическому диску. Это можно сделать путем оптимизации параметров кэширования, таких как размер кэша и алгоритм замещения данных. Рекомендуется провести тестирование различных настроек для достижения наилучшей производительности.
- Использование индексов: Создание индексов на часто используемые поля в файловой базе 1С позволяет ускорить процесс поиска и сортировки данных. Индексы помогут уменьшить время выполнения запросов и сократить количество обращений к диску.
- Очистка кэша: Регулярная очистка кэша может помочь устранить проблемы с накоплением лишних данных, которые могут замедлить работу системы. Рекомендуется настроить автоматическую очистку кэша или проводить ее вручную при необходимости.
- Оптимизация работы с памятью: Увеличение доступной оперативной памяти и оптимизация ее использования может существенно ускорить работу с файловой базой 1С. Рекомендуется проверить требования к памяти системы и настроить ее соответствующим образом.
- Использование кэширования на клиентской стороне: В файловой базе 1С можно использовать кэширование на клиентской стороне, чтобы уменьшить нагрузку на сервер и повысить скорость работы системы. Это можно сделать, например, с помощью выборочной предзагрузки данных или кэширования отдельных запросов.
Применение данных подходов к оптимизации работы с кэшем может значительно повысить производительность файловой базы 1С и избавиться от тормозов при работе с данными. Рекомендуется провести анализ и тестирование каждого подхода для достижения наилучших результатов.
Увеличение размера кэша для улучшения производительности
При увеличении размера кэша, большая часть данных будет сохраняться в оперативной памяти, что сократит время доступа к ним и ускорит операции с базой данных. Это будет особенно полезно при работе с большими объемами данных или при выполнении сложных запросов.
Как увеличить размер кэша в 1С:
- Откройте конфигурацию базы данных в 1С.
- Перейдите в режим «Режим работы с базой данных».
- Выберите раздел «Настройки» или «Параметры».
- Найдите параметр, отвечающий за размер кэша (обычно это параметр с названием «Размер кэша»).
- Увеличьте значение параметра на нужное количество мегабайт.
- Сохраните изменения и закройте конфигурацию базы данных.
После увеличения размера кэша, перезапустите файловую базу 1С. Это позволит применить новые настройки и начать использовать увеличенный кэш.
Важно:
При увеличении размера кэша следует учитывать объем доступной оперативной памяти на компьютере. Если размер кэша будет превышать доступную память, это может привести к снижению производительности или даже к аварийному завершению работы системы. Рекомендуется консультироваться с системным администратором или специалистом по настройке 1С перед внесением изменений в настройки кэша.
Увеличение размера кэша — один из методов оптимизации работы файловой базы 1С и улучшения ее производительности. Комбинирование этого метода с другими методами, такими как оптимизация запросов или настройка индексов, может помочь достичь еще большего ускорения работы с базой данных.
Использование быстрого кэша для повышения скорости доступа к данным
Быстрый кэш представляет собой специальную память, которая хранит наиболее часто используемые данные системы. Вместо того, чтобы обращаться к файловой системе каждый раз, когда требуется доступ к данным, система может использовать кэш для более эффективного получения информации.
Использование быстрого кэша позволяет значительно снизить время работы с данными, так как данные из кэша загружаются намного быстрее, чем с диска. Кроме того, кэш также помогает снизить нагрузку на файловую систему, что повышает ее производительность в целом.
Для настройки и использования быстрого кэша необходимо выполнить ряд шагов. Во-первых, необходимо определить, какие данные следует кешировать. Обычно кешируются данные, которые часто запрашиваются и долго загружаются с диска, например, справочники или отчеты, с которыми работают несколько пользователей одновременно.
После того как определены данные для кэширования, необходимо настроить параметры кэша, такие как его размер и время жизни данных в кэше. Размер кэша должен быть достаточно большим, чтобы вмещать все кешируемые данные, но не таким большим, чтобы потреблять слишком много памяти системы.
Важно также установить оптимальное время жизни данных в кэше. Это поможет избежать ситуации, когда устаревшие данные хранятся в кэше и могут привести к некорректным результатам работы системы. Обычно время жизни данных подбирается опытным путем в зависимости от конкретных требований и характера работы системы.
Использование быстрого кэша является одним из эффективных способов увеличения скорости работы файловой базы 1С и снижения нагрузки на файловую систему. Настройка кэша требует определенных знаний и опыта, но может существенно повысить производительность системы и обеспечить более быстрый доступ к данным.
Разделение базы данных на отдельные файлы
При разделении базы данных следует следующим образом:
- Выделить отдельный файл для каждого объекта базы данных, например, таблицы или индекса;
- Разместить файлы на отдельных физических дисках или на разных разделах одного диска;
- Провести настройку системы таким образом, чтобы каждому файлу было выделено достаточно пространства, чтобы избежать фрагментации.
Разделение базы данных на отдельные файлы позволяет увеличить скорость доступа к данным за счет распределения нагрузки на дисковую подсистему. Благодаря этому процесс чтения и записи данных становится более эффективным и быстрым, что приводит к улучшению общей производительности системы.
Для успешного разделения базы данных на отдельные файлы необходимо внимательно спланировать структуру файловой системы и учесть особенности работы конкретной системы. Также следует регулярно проводить мониторинг и оптимизацию, а при необходимости вносить корректировки в разделение базы данных, чтобы добиться наилучших результатов.
Вопрос-ответ:
Почему моя файловая база 1С работает медленно и часто тормозит?
Существует несколько возможных причин, по которым файловая база 1С может работать медленно и тормозить. Во-первых, это может быть связано с недостаточными ресурсами сервера или компьютера, на котором установлена база данных. Во-вторых, проблемы могут быть вызваны неправильной настройкой базы данных или наличием ошибок в ее структуре. Также, возможно, база данных перегружена лишними данными или сложными запросами. Чтобы увеличить скорость работы файловой базы и избавиться от тормозов, необходимо проанализировать причины и принять соответствующие меры.
Какие меры можно принять для увеличения скорости работы файловой базы 1С?
Существует несколько мер, которые можно принять для увеличения скорости работы файловой базы 1С. Во-первых, можно проверить и оптимизировать настройки сервера или компьютера, на котором расположена база данных. Например, увеличить объем оперативной памяти или производительность процессора. Во-вторых, необходимо провести анализ и оптимизацию структуры базы данных, устранить ошибки и избавиться от лишних данных. Также, можно оптимизировать запросы к базе данных, например, путем использования индексов или упрощения сложных запросов. Однако, перед внесением любых изменений, рекомендуется сделать резервную копию базы данных, чтобы в случае ошибки можно было восстановить данные.
Какие инструменты и техники можно использовать для оптимизации работы файловой базы 1С?
Для оптимизации работы файловой базы 1С можно использовать различные инструменты и техники. Например, можно воспользоваться инструментами администрирования баз данных, предоставляемыми самой 1С, такими как «Конфигуратор», «Администрирование баз данных» и другими. Эти инструменты позволяют проводить анализ и оптимизацию структуры базы данных, а также настраивать параметры работы базы данных. Также, можно использовать специализированные программы и утилиты, предназначенные для анализа и оптимизации баз данных. Важно помнить, что перед использованием любых инструментов и техник необходимо учитывать специфику конкретной базы данных и консультироваться с профессионалами.
Почему скорость работы файловой базы 1С может быть замедленной?
Одной из причин замедления работы файловой базы 1С может быть недостаточное количество оперативной памяти на сервере, на котором располагается база данных. Также, проблемы с производительностью могут возникать из-за неправильной настройки системных параметров или из-за некорректного использования индексов в базе данных. Неэффективный дизайн конфигурации и плохо оптимизированные запросы могут также замедлить работу файловой базы 1С.